Works decently in 0.73 (2009-07-06 23:59) HunterZ
Installed from CD + 1.5 patch under DOSBox 0.73, selected Bypass option. Got a warning about not enough memory detected (31M+Swap) even with memsize=63, but the same seems to run. Level and dialogue loading time was terribly slow even after following instructions on the UESP wiki to copy game files to the HDD. Eventually I made a BIN/CUE (not ISO because of the audio tracks) image of the CD and imgmount'ed it in DOSBox and the game runs quite well. I have to run with the "Low" resolution setting though because the framerate is a tad too low if I choose "High".

Runs in DOSBox v0.65 (2006-04-12 21:54) DisChaotica
It's very, very, very slow but Battlespire finally runs in DOSBox v0.65. I had to use the "-freesize 500" parameter when I mounted the c-drive. Also, Setsound crashed DOSBox when it tried to autodetect an AWE64 (use Soundblaster) Otherwise, the install went without a hitch. You can play the game in SVGA; create a character works, and you can get into the game itself. But it is very slow (1FPS), so its not really playable yet.
More info -- (2006-02-02 01:30) tejon
The game exits with the error message:
"Could not initialize VESA 15 bit 640x480 mode."

Game includes UniVBE and a config option to add or remove it in the batch file (this is the 'normal' and 'bypass' mentioned by Jareth above); same error results either way.

Note that running directly under XP, the above error occurs with 'bypass,' but with 'normal' the error changes to "Unable to install or detect VBE 2.0..."
